BACKGROUND: Phyllodes tumors (PTs) represent uncommon fibroepithelial lesions of the breast that express c-Kit and platelet-derived growth factor receptor-alpha, similar to gastrointestinal stromal tumors (GISTs). 'Activating' mutations in these genes underlie responsiveness of GISTs to imatinib. Standard treatment for breast PTs is wide local excision, with no role for targeted therapies. PATIENTS AND METHODS: c-Kit (CD117) expression was investigated by immunohistochemistry in 17 cases of breast PTs. Fourteen of these cases were also subjected to KIT mutation analysis by dideoxynucleotide sequencing. RESULTS: Five out of 17 (29%) tumors showed weak stromal staining for CD117. No previously described 'activating' mutations were found in exons 9, 11, 13, or 17 of the KIT gene. A silent germline point mutation was found in exon 17 of one case. CONCLUSION: These data do not suggest a pathogenetic role for KIT in breast PTs. Inhibition of c-Kit signaling is unlikely to be helpful in this condition.
